Poland declares a state of natural disaster due to floods, will ask for EU help

AUTHOR: M.J.
Poland is introducing a state of natural disaster due to torrential floods in the southwest and south of the country after the heavy rains brought to Central Europe by Cyclone Boris, Polish Prime Minister Donald Tusk decided.
"We will also ask for help from the European Union. No one will be left to fend for themselves," said Prime Minister Tusk, who has been visiting the most vulnerable areas with some of the ministers since Friday.
In these floods, unlike the previous devastating ones in 1997 and 2010, the problem is not the biggest rivers, but the mountain streams, rivulets and smaller rivers that the ordinary Pole often does not even know the name of, which have turned into torrents, as Polish meteorologists say. into monsters, destroy bridges, breach dams and embankments, take away houses and flood one town after another in the valleys in southwestern and southern Poland.
"The most difficult situation is in the Voivodeship of Lower Silesia and the Opole Voivodeship. The biggest help is needed in the Klod Basin. All forces of the fire brigade, police and army were engaged. We transferred the helicopters that are evacuating people in the Klodska basin. A different evacuation is not possible," said the Polish Minister of Defense Vladislav Košnjak-Kamiš.
